Man sought for violent sex attack at Keele TTC station
The victim, who did not know her attacker, suffered minor injuries

An unidentified man is wanted for sexually assaulting a stranger at a TTC station in the city’s west end early Saturday.
Toronto Police say officers responded to a sex assault call in the area of Keele St. and Bloor St. W. around 1:40 a.m.
“It is reported that the victim and suspect were inside the TTC Keele Subway Station on the westbound platform,” Const. Shannon Eames said.
She said the man allegedly assaulted the victim, pulled her to the ground, then sexually assaulted her.
“A witness interrupted the assault and the suspect fled the area on foot,” Eames said, explaining the female suffered “minor injuries.”
“The victim and suspect are not known to each another,” she added.
Police are looking for a man who is described as 5-foot-6, with a medium-to-heavy build and brown facial hair. He was wearing a green/beige jacket, black jeans, black running shoes, a black hooded sweatshirt with a “Toronto Raptors” logo, and a purple baseball hat with a yellow brim and a “Minnesota Vikings” logo on the front.

Investigators have released a security camera image of a suspect hoping members of the public recognize him and come forward.
Anyone with information regarding the identity or whereabouts of the suspect is urged to call the Sex Crimes Unit at 416-808-7474 or Crime Stoppers anonymously at 1-800-222-TIPS (8477).
